Save Big on Coursera Plus. 7,000+ courses at $160 off. Limited Time Only!
Explore a conference talk from USENIX ATC '21 that introduces MapperX, an innovative extension to DM-cache designed to enhance crash recovery times and availability in hybrid storage devices. Learn about the challenges faced by current DM-cache implementations and how MapperX addresses these issues through an on-disk adaptive bit-tree (ABT) for synchronous metadata maintenance. Discover the technical details behind MapperX's controlled metadata persistence overhead and fast crash recovery capabilities, leveraging spatial locality of block writes. Examine the implementation of MapperX for Linux DM-cache module and review experimental results demonstrating its significant performance improvements over the original DM-cache based hybrid device in crash recovery scenarios.